Pavlov's position on the inheritance of acquired characteristics was used to test selected theses of Laudan et al. (1986) concerning scientific change. It was determined that, despite negative experimental findings, Pavlov continued to accept the possibility of the inheritance of acquired habits. This confirms the main thesis I that, once accepted, theories persist despite negative experimental evidence. Pavolv's adherence to the concept of inheritance of acquired characteristics might possibly be explained by his early experiences. Adolescent readings of a popularized version of Darwin's theory, which included the concept of inheritance of acquired characteristics, profoundly influenced Pavlov's subsequent intellectual life. Overwhelmed by the theory, as originally presented, Pavlov was unable to alter his views in light of contrary findings.  相似文献

American psychologists are informed on Pavlov’s work on conditional reflexes but not on the full development of his theory of higher nervous activity. This article shows that Pavlov’s theory of higher nervous activity dealt with concepts that concerned contemporary psychologists. Pavlov used the conditioning of the salivary reflex for methodological purposes. Pavlov’s theory of higher nervous activity encompassed overt behavior, neural processes, and the conscious experience. The strong Darwinian element of Pavlov’s theory, with its stress on the higher organisms’ adaptation, is described. With regard to learning, Pavlov, at the end of his scholarly career, proposed that although all learning involves the formation of associations, the organism’s adaptation to the environment is established through conditioning, but the accumulation of knowledge is established by trial and error.  相似文献

文化演化是多学科共同关心的文化研究主题。文化演化的认知视角是心理学家切入该研究主题的一种方式, 它着眼于社会文化环境中的个体认知, 研究个体在社会学习过程中对文化信息的加工、改变、记忆与提取。文化演化的认知视角借用达尔文生物演化理论, 涉及文化传承、创新、选择三个子领域, 提出了文化演化的三原则: 遗传、变异、选择。文化传承的路径包括模仿和教导, 类型分为工具性与习俗性文化传承; 文化创新具有层次性, 人类特有的累积性文化演化建立在文化创新的基础之上, 体现了文化创新的代际传递; 基于行为生态学和人类认知机制的文化选择造成了文化信息的差异化适应。未来研究可以从研究概念、研究思路、研究方法三方面推进认知视角下的文化演化研究, 探索更高层次的文化创新, 扩展文化演化的前因变量, 结合新技术加深对文化演化的理解; 发挥文化演化对文化心理学研究的助推作用, 研究文化混搭、个性心理特征对文化演化的影响。  相似文献

This paper examined D. Joravsky's (1989) hypothesis that I.P. Pavlov dogmatically refused to acknowledge that classical conditioning can be mediated by subcortical regions of the large cerebral hemispheres. Decortication literature from 1901 to 1936 was reviewed. The early studies available to Pavlov, who died in 1936, showed that decortication does not allow the establishment of new or retaining of old conditional reflexes (CRs). G.P. Zeleny?'s later experiments(1930) suggested that the establishment of primitive CRs in decorticated dogs was possible. Pavlov never denied this possibility but cautioned that Zeleny?'s experiments could have been methodologically flawed. Although Joravsky's original hypothesis on Pavlov's position on the relation between decortication and the establishment of CRs is by and large accepted, it must be stressed that Pavlov's theory of higher nervous activity was primarily concerned with the function of the brain in the higher organism's struggle for existence. Within this context the cortical, rather than subcortical, processes play the decisive role in the organism's adaptation to the changing external environment.  相似文献

During the 1920s, I. P. Pavlov’s scholarly interests broadened to consider problem-solving. Distrusting Wolfgang Köhler’s Gestalt explanation of the problemsolving process and its interspecies aspects, Pavlov performed, from 1933 to 1936, a number of experiments, including a replication of Köhler’s building experiment, using chimpanzees as subjects. Confirming Köhler’s findings, Pavlov explained the problemsolving process in terms of unconditional reflexes and the establishment, by Pavlovian conditioning and the Thorndikian method of trial and error, of temporary neural connections identical, on the psychological level, to associations. In contrast to Köhler’s “structural” explanation, Pavlov emphasized the processes of analysis and synthesis. According to Pavlov insight is achieved progressively—as the result of the organism’s problem-solving behavior—contradicting Köhler’s thesis of a sudden subjective reorganization of the environmental situation. Pavlov explained interspecies differences among higher organisms in terms of the range of a species behavior, with the second signal system as the main distinguishing characteristic between human and nonhuman species.  相似文献

About 1880, Rudolf Heidenhain, then Professor of Physiology and Histology at the University of Breslau, experimentally studied hypnotic phenomena. Heidenhain explained hypnosis physiologically, in terms of cortical inhibition. Subsequently, I. P. Pavlov, who in 1877 and again in 1884 was Heidenhain’s student at Breslau, encountered hypnotic phenomena during conditional reflex experiments. In 1910, Pavlov described hypnotic states and explained them (as had Heidenhain three decades earlier), in terms of partial inhibition of the cortex. As the concepts of inhibition and excitation are cornerstones of Pavlov’s theory of higher nervous activity, it is of historical interest to search for influences that led Pavlov to incorporate the concept of inhibition into his theory. It is most likely that Pavlov first encountered the concept of central inhibition in the 1860s when reading I. M. Sechenov’sThe Reflexes of the Brain (1863/1866) and that the importance of the concept was augmented by Heidenhain’s use of it in explaining hypnotic phenomena.  相似文献

The translation of Pavlov's lectures (Pavlov, 1927) provided English-speaking psychologists with access to the full scope of Pavlov's research and theoretical ideas. The impact this had on their study of the psychology of learning can be assessed by examining influential books in this area. This reveals that Watson (1924) had been highly effective in promoting the misleading idea that Pavlov was a fellow S-R theorist. This assumption was not questioned by Tolman (1932), Hilgard and Marquis (1940) or by Hull (1943). However, this mistake was not made by Skinner (1938), who also provided the strongest arguments against Pavlov's belief that behavioral effects required explanation in terms of physiological processes. Post-1927 most learning research in the English-speaking countries continued to use instrumental, rather than Pavlovian, conditioning procedures. Nevertheless, many of the issues addressed by this research were ones that Pavlov had been the first to raise, so that his major influence can be seen as that of defining a research program for subsequent students of learning.  相似文献

On 25 September, 1923, two days before his 74th birthday, Ivan Petrovich Pavlov stood before a class of medical students assembled in the auditorium of his Alma Mater, the Military Medical Academy in Leningrad. Pavlov, the recipient of the Nobel prize in medicine in 1904 for his work in physiology, was about to address his first class of the new academic year, and, as was his custom, he had prepared his first lecture on a general theme. This was an especially significant address, however, for in it Pavlov reviewed the impressions he had gathered during his travels in Western Europe and the United States in the summer of 1923, and he criticised the prevailing ideology of Soviet communism by attacking the ideas of Nikolai Ivanovich Bukharin, then the leading expositor of Bolshevik Marxism. Misconceptions about basic genetic concepts and inheritance patterns may be widespread in the general population. This paper investigates understandings of genetics, illness causality and inheritance among British Pakistanis referred to a UK genetics clinic. During participant observation of genetics clinic consultations and semi-structured interviews in Urdu or English in respondents’ homes, we identified an array of environmental, behavioral and spiritual understandings of the causes of medical and intellectual problems. Misconceptions about the location of genetic information in the body and of genetic mechanisms of inheritance were common, reflected the range of everyday theories observed for White British patients and included the belief that a child receives more genetic material from the father than the mother. Despite some participants’ conversational use of genetic terminology, some patients had assimilated genetic information in ways that conflict with genetic theory with potentially serious clinical consequences. Additionally, skepticism of genetic theories of illness reflected a rejection of a dominant discourse of genetic risk that stigmatizes cousin marriages. Patients referred to genetics clinics may not easily surrender their lay or personal theories about the causes of their own or their child’s condition and their understandings of genetic risk. Genetic counselors may need to identify, work with and at times challenge patients’ understandings of illness causality and inheritance.  相似文献

This statement, first presented at a plenary session of the Pavlovian Society on 9 October 1992, in Los Angeles, California, attempts to assess the recently released speech delivered by Ivan Pavlov in 1923, but publicly brought to light only in 1991, on the subject of “Communist Dogmatism and the Autonomy of Science.” This speech, noteworthy for the courage of the delivery under adverse circumstances no less than the contents of its remarks, compels a new estimate of the place of science in a totalitarian system boasting an ideology of physiological psychology. It also sheds new light on the Russian Nobel laureate and pioneer in the areas of behavior modification induced by the functions of the higher nervous system. These remarks take an in-depth view of American radical and Marxian appraisals — how they followed the Soviet lead in harnessing Pavlov to the Communist cause, and in attempting to discredit the work of Sigmund Freud. This lethal combination of Communist political needs and ideological proclivities served to rationalize the implementation of slave labor as work therapy during the Stalinist era. The linkage of Pavlov to Makarenko in education and Michurin in biology serves as a case study in the manufacture of tradition. The collapse of the Soviet system permits a recasting of the history of science and Pavlov’s place in Russian life. Such new conditions also provide a lesson in the distortive role of ideology in the evolution of modern science.  相似文献

The general character of the Pavlovians and their role in the experimental investigation of conditioned reflexes is discussed. From 1897 to 1936, Ivan P. Pavlov had at least 146 co-workers and he was closely involved in their experimental work. The social background, nationality, and gender of the Pavlovians are described together with the daily routine in the laboratories. It is pointed out that, despite Pavlov's authoritarian style, the Pavlovians characterized him as the epitome of a scholar and an admirable human being. It is concluded that the work in the laboratories was truly a cooperative effort between Pavlov and his co-workers.  相似文献

Effect of Person     
The role of the experimenter in the behavioral study, although recognized by Darwin, Pavlov, psychiatrists and others, has not been adequately evaluated in terms of the quantitative measures of the CR. Our study in this paper concerns especially the cardiac changes induced by “Person” in normal and pathological animals—monkey, dog, cat, opossum, guinea pig and rabbit. Owing to the greater sensitivity of the cardiovascular and respiratory systems, these are more reliable and delicate measures than the usual somatic muscular ones. The Person can be used as an unconditional stimulus on the basis of which conditional reflexes are formed. Person has an especially pronounced effect on neurotic animals—shown often in a more pronounced way in the cardiorespiratory responses than in the more superficial behavioral ones. This Effect of Person may provide insights into the production of neurosis as well as some of the beneficial effects of therapy, e.g., the personal factor of the therapist.  相似文献

Skinner's Science and Human Behavior marked a transition from a treatment of behavior that took physics as its reference science to one that emphasized behavior as a fundamental part of the subject matter of biology. The book includes what may be Skinner's earliest statement about the similarity of operant selection to Darwinian natural selection in phylogeny. Other major topics discussed in the book included multiple causation, private events, the self, and social contingencies. Among the important antecedents were Skinner's own Behavior of Organisms and Keller & Schoenfeld's Pincinples of Psychology. Current developments in education, behavioral economics, and some behavior therapies can be attributed at least in part to Skinner's seminal work. The effective behavioral analysis of governmental and religious systems will probably depend on elaborations of our understanding of verbal behavior.  相似文献

Research on conditional reflex (CR) in Pavlov’s Physiological Laboratory has preceded Twitmyer’s work on conditioning at the University of Pennsylvania by 3 or 4 years. The events in Pavlov’s laboratory lead toward the postulation of a new paradigm that rejected the Cartesians conceptualization of the reflex as a mechanistic response to stimuli by replacing it with the Darwinian notion of the organism’s adaptation to the environmental conditions. The Pavlovian paradigm rejected the Wundtian method in favor of the objective, conditional reflex method.  相似文献
